Mostly nowadays, due to high rate of attrition in the industry especially IT and BPO sector, companies are losing great amounts of money and resources into training new candidates. The trend with the freshers is that they enter a company, learn the skills of the trade and leave within few months to greener pastures. Hence the recruiters now only are taking in experienced candidates.

Therefore it would be prudent to do a little bit of homework before you appear for any interview, check and make sure what are the criteria they are looking for. This way, you will better prepared and will know what to expect.

The job requirements specify qualification as well as experience. So apply for posts that need freshers without experience. It may also be good idea to work with some small concern in the beginning on no salary or for small amount with the aim to get experience. You may also work initially as self employed person, if necessary, by teaming with other persons similarly placed. After gaining experience this way, you may apply for higher post.
